UTEP Study Reveals Nanoplastics and 'Forever Chemicals' Threat to Human Health

Nanoplastics and per- and polyfluoroalkyl substances (PFAS) disrupt critical proteins in breast milk, infant formulas, and other vital molecules, according to a new study by The University of Texas at El Paso. The research found that these compounds can alter the structure of proteins, potentially leading to developmental issues. The findings, published in the Journal of the American Chemical Society and ACS Applied Materials and Interfaces, shed light on the serious health risks posed by these ubiquitous pollutants.
